我们都知道\TeX
生成 TeX 徽标和\LaTeX
生成 LaTeX 徽标。但似乎没有像\BibTeX
生成 BibTeX 徽标这样的命令,而 Wikipedia 采用了复杂的解决方法:\mathrm{B{\scriptstyle{IB}} \! T\!_{\displaystyle E} \! X}
。那么有没有简单的命令呢?(我觉得Bib\TeX
不行,因为大小写不符合官方的)
答案1
过去的情况是dtk-徽标软件包提供的命令,如“\BibTeX”。它是动态库包裹。
\documentclass{article}
\usepackage{dtk-logos}
\begin{document}
\BibTeX % Doesn't work in TeXLive 2015
\end{document}
然而,dtk-logos
仍在开发中,可能会发生变化。更安全的选择是使用hologo 包。
\documentclass{article}
\usepackage{hologo}
\begin{document}
\hologo{BibTeX}
\end{document}
事实上,的当前版本dtk-logos
可以加载hologo
,但我认为最好hologo
直接加载,直到的开发dtk-logos
完成。
答案2
FWIW,Oren Patashnik 的原始 BibTeX 文档\BibTeX
在相应的前导中定义一个命令.tex 文件:
\def\BibTeX{{\rm B\kern-.05em{\sc i\kern-.025em b}\kern-.08em
T\kern-.1667em\lower.7ex\hbox{E}\kern-.125emX}}
较大的标题版本是手工制作的,如下所示:
\title{B\kern-.05em{\large I}\kern-.025em{\large B}\kern-.08em\TeX ing}
答案3
我不认为官方的BibTeX 徽标。通常我采用\textsc{Bib}\TeX
,但也\textsc{Bib}\negthinspace\TeX
可能使用。$\mathrm{B\scriptstyle IB}\!$\TeX
如果字体没有小写字母,则可以使用此技巧。
答案4
我拥有的版本dtklogos
(2014/11/15 v2.2) 不再定义\BibTeX
,而是加载hologo
包。后者没有定义\BibTeX
,而是\hologo{BibTeX}
。不幸的是,dtklogos
没有为它安装向后兼容的命令。
\documentclass{standalone}
\usepackage{hologo}
\begin{document}
\hologo{BibTeX}
\end{document}